This week in Kindergarten…
We have growing writers! We began a new unit this week on writing lists. We thought of why would need to write a list (grocery lists, Christmas lists, etc). Our first list was a list of our school friends. We spent three different writing times writing all 22 names. The kids did such a great job and were so proud of their work. Our next list was a list of pets. We are using sound spelling to write these words. We think of the word, say the word slowly and then listen for each sound. We write the sound that we hear. This is a long process. Once again I am so proud of the work I saw!
